mysql自连接查询的sql语句 mysql自连接应用场景

【mysql自连接查询的sql语句 mysql自连接应用场景】导读:MySQL自连接是指在同一张表中进行连接操作,这种连接方式常用于需要查询同一张表的数据时 。本文将介绍几个MySQL自连接的应用场景 。
1. 查询同一张表中的父子关系
在有些情况下 , 我们需要查询同一张表中的父子关系,例如查询公司的组织架构或者树形结构等 。此时可以使用MySQL自连接来实现 。
2. 查找同一张表中的相似记录
有时候我们需要查找同一张表中的相似记录,例如查找用户表中姓名相同或者电话号码相同的用户信息 。此时可以使用MySQL自连接来实现 。
3. 计算同一张表中的累计值
如果需要计算同一张表中某个字段的累计值 , 可以使用MySQL自连接来实现 。例如,计算销售订单中每个客户的总销售额 。
4. 查询同一张表中的循环引用
在某些情况下,同一张表中可能存在循环引用的情况,例如查询员工的上级领导和下属员工信息 。此时可以使用MySQL自连接来实现 。
总结:MySQL自连接是一种非常灵活的查询方式 , 可以帮助我们解决许多复杂的问题 。但是,在使用过程中需要注意避免死循环或者查询效率低下等问题 。

    推荐阅读